  • East, west, north, south: How to fix your local cluster routes
    9 projects | dev.to | 4 Apr 2025
    Another problem is that the default certificates issued by Traefik, are not trusted by other systems or browsers. So we frequently need to bypass security warnings, which by itself is indicative of a problem and encourages bad habits. Furthermore, even if we manage to configure our setup to use the ingress service from within the cluster, it depends on the backend application if it allows bypassing TLS host checking.
  • Cloudflare is almost perfect
    4 projects | dev.to | 16 Jan 2025
    Sidecar containers: Google Cloud Run has a cool feature where you can run multiple containers next to each other. So for example, if you want to run Caddy or Traefik as a reverse proxy for your ingress container and then have both your web frontend container & backend api container co-located in the same service, you can do that & have everything be super low latency.
